Abstract
271,222. British Thomson-Houston Co., Ltd., Clinker, R. C., and Lucas, G. S. C. April 14, 1926. Thermionic amplifiers. - In valve amplifiers operating in push-pull or in parallel, the filaments being fed in series, provision is made for separately adjusting the grid and plate voltages in order to maintain symmetry in operation. As shown in Fig. 1, the filaments of two push-pull amplifiers V<a>, V<b> are fed from any suitable source, such as the house mains in series with resistances Rp, Rg, from the latter of which separate tappings are taken to the two grids through the split windings a, b of the input transformer Ti. Fig. 2 shows a similar pushpull arrangement in which the plate potentials are also separately divided from a resistance Rp through the divided windings a<1>, b<1> of the output transformer T<o>. Fig. 3 illustrates two valves V<a>, V<b> operating in parallel. The filaments are fed in series from a suitable source, whilst the grid impulses are supplied in parallel through two separate coupling condensers A, B. The grid leaks A<1>, B<1> are separately tapped to a common biasing battery Bg. The plate voltages are equalized through the two sections of the split output transformer To.
